Pakistan Triumphs in Opening Match of Asian Team Snooker Championship

In an impressive display of skill and teamwork, Pakistan emerged victorious in the opening match of the Asian Team Snooker Championship, defeating Saudi Arabia 2 in a decisive win. The championship, held in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ia’s capital, witnessed a stellar performance from the Pakistani snooker team, marking a strong start in the prestigious event.

The Pakistani team, comprising Asjad Iqbal and Owais Munir, showcased their prowess in the team event, securing a 3-0 victory against their Saudi counterparts. Looking ahead, the Pakistani team is set to face Myanmar in their second match of the tournament today. This match is expected to be another thrilling encounter as the team aims to continue their winning streak and advance further in the championship. The competition is fierce, with 18 teams participating, including three from the host nation, Saudi Arabia.
